1. Content Creation Tools

Canva

Canva is a user-friendly graphic design tool that allows users to create stunning visuals for social media posts, banners, and advertisements. It offers a wide range of templates, images, and design elements, making it accessible for those with no design experience.

  • Features:
    • Drag-and-drop interface
    • Extensive template library
    • Collaboration options for teams

Adobe Spark

Adobe Spark is another powerful tool for creating social media graphics, web pages, and video stories. It integrates seamlessly with other Adobe products, providing a professional touch to your content.

  • Features:
    • Customizable templates
    • Animation capabilities for videos
    • Integration with Adobe Creative Cloud

Visme

Visme is a versatile content creation tool that excels in creating infographics, presentations, and social media visuals. It’s perfect for marketers looking to convey information in a visually appealing manner.

  • Features:
    • Interactive presentation options
    • Data visualization tools
    • User-friendly interface

2. Video Editing Tools

InVideo

InVideo is a video creation platform that allows you to make professional-looking videos for social media quickly. With pre-made templates and an extensive media library, you can create engaging video content without prior video editing experience.

  • Features:
    • Thousands of templates
    • Text-to-video functionality
    • Stock media library

Animoto

Animoto is a straightforward video-making tool that lets users transform photos and video clips into professional video slideshows. It’s particularly useful for creating promotional videos and highlights.

  • Features:
    • Drag-and-drop video creation
    • Music library for background tracks
    • Social media sharing options

Filmora

Filmora is a robust video editing software that provides powerful editing features, making it suitable for both beginners and advanced users. Its user-friendly interface simplifies the video editing process, allowing for quick content creation.

  • Features:
    • Extensive library of effects and transitions
    • Audio editing features
    • Multi-track timeline for detailed editing

3. Content Scheduling Tools

Buffer

Buffer is a social media management tool that allows users to schedule posts across multiple platforms. Its intuitive interface helps marketers plan their content strategy and track performance effectively.

  • Features:
    • Post scheduling across various social networks
    • Analytics to measure engagement
    • Content calendar for planning

Hootsuite

Hootsuite is one of the most popular social media management platforms. It enables users to manage multiple social accounts, schedule posts, and analyze performance from a single dashboard.

  • Features:
    • Comprehensive analytics and reporting
    • Social listening capabilities
    • Team collaboration tools

Later

Later is a visual content planner specifically designed for Instagram. It allows users to schedule posts, visually plan their feed, and track engagement metrics.

  • Features:
    • Drag-and-drop post scheduling
    • Hashtag suggestions for increased reach
    • Visual content calendar

4. Content Optimization Tools

BuzzSumo

BuzzSumo is a content research tool that helps you identify trending topics and successful content within your niche. This insight allows you to create relevant and engaging social media posts.

  • Features:
    • Content discovery based on keywords
    • Analysis of top-performing content
    • Influencer identification for collaboration

CoSchedule Headline Analyzer

CoSchedule’s Headline Analyzer is a tool that evaluates your headlines based on various factors, including word balance and length. It helps you craft catchy titles that attract attention on social media.

  • Features:
    • Headline scoring system
    • Suggestions for improvement
    • SEO and readability tips

SEMrush

SEMrush is an all-in-one marketing toolkit that provides insights into SEO, content marketing, and social media. It allows marketers to track their performance and refine their strategies accordingly.

  • Features:
    • Keyword research and tracking
    • Content audit capabilities
    • Competitor analysis tools

5. Content Collaboration Tools

Trello

Trello is a project management tool that helps teams collaborate on content creation. It allows users to organize tasks, assign responsibilities, and track progress visually.

  • Features:
    • Customizable boards for project tracking
    • Collaboration through comments and attachments
    • Integration with various productivity tools

Google Workspace

Google Workspace offers a suite of tools, including Google Docs and Google Sheets, which facilitate collaboration on content creation. Teams can work simultaneously on documents, making it easier to brainstorm and edit content.

  • Features:
    • Real-time collaboration
    • Commenting and suggesting features
    • Cloud storage for easy access

Slack

Slack is a communication tool that enables teams to collaborate effectively. It allows for instant messaging, file sharing, and integration with other tools, streamlining the content creation process.

  • Features:
    • Organized channels for different topics
    • Direct messaging capabilities
    • Integration with productivity apps

FAQs

1. What are social media marketing tools?

Social media marketing tools are applications or platforms that help businesses create, manage, and analyze their content on social media. They streamline processes like content creation, scheduling, and performance tracking.

2. Why should I use video content for social media?

Video content is highly engaging and often leads to higher conversion rates. It captures attention quickly and is easily shareable, making it an effective tool for reaching a wider audience.

3. How often should I post on social media?

Posting frequency can vary by platform. Generally, it’s recommended to post at least once a day on platforms like Instagram and Facebook, while Twitter may require several posts daily due to its fast-paced nature.

4. What types of content perform best on social media?

Visual content, such as images and videos, tends to perform best. Additionally, educational content, user-generated content, and posts that encourage interaction (like polls) can boost engagement.

5. How do I measure the success of my social media marketing efforts?

Success can be measured through various metrics, including engagement rates, follower growth, click-through rates, and conversions. Tools like Google Analytics and Hootsuite can help track these metrics.

6. Can I automate my social media posting?

Yes, many tools like Buffer and Hootsuite allow you to schedule posts in advance, automating your social media marketing efforts and ensuring consistent posting.
